2018-09-26 05:46:29 +00:00
|
|
|
#
|
|
|
|
# QUICC Engine Drivers
|
|
|
|
#
|
2019-05-12 11:59:12 +00:00
|
|
|
config QE
|
|
|
|
bool "Enable support for QUICC Engine"
|
2020-04-29 09:26:59 +00:00
|
|
|
depends on PPC && !DM_ETH
|
2019-05-12 11:59:12 +00:00
|
|
|
default y if ARCH_T1040 || ARCH_T1042 || ARCH_T1024 || ARCH_P1021 \
|
|
|
|
|| ARCH_P1025
|
|
|
|
help
|
|
|
|
Chose this option to add support for the QUICC Engine.
|
|
|
|
|
2018-09-26 05:46:29 +00:00
|
|
|
config U_QE
|
|
|
|
bool "Enable support for U QUICC Engine"
|
|
|
|
default y if (ARCH_LS1021A && !SD_BOOT && !NAND_BOOT && !QSPI_BOOT) \
|
|
|
|
|| (TARGET_T1024QDS) \
|
|
|
|
|| (TARGET_T1024RDB) \
|
|
|
|
|| (TARGET_T1040QDS && !NOBQFMAN) \
|
|
|
|
|| (TARGET_LS1043ARDB && !SPL_NO_QE && !NAND_BOOT && !QSPI_BOOT)
|
|
|
|
help
|
|
|
|
Choose this option to add support for U QUICC Engine.
|
2019-05-12 11:59:12 +00:00
|
|
|
|
|
|
|
choice
|
|
|
|
prompt "QUICC Engine FMan ethernet firmware location"
|
|
|
|
depends on FMAN_ENET || QE
|
|
|
|
default SYS_QE_FMAN_FW_IN_ROM
|
|
|
|
|
|
|
|
config SYS_QE_FMAN_FW_IN_NOR
|
|
|
|
bool "NOR flash"
|
|
|
|
|
|
|
|
config SYS_QE_FMAN_FW_IN_NAND
|
|
|
|
bool "NAND flash"
|
|
|
|
|
|
|
|
config SYS_QE_FMAN_FW_IN_SPIFLASH
|
|
|
|
bool "SPI flash"
|
|
|
|
|
|
|
|
config SYS_QE_FMAN_FW_IN_MMC
|
|
|
|
bool "MMC"
|
|
|
|
|
|
|
|
config SYS_QE_FMAN_FW_IN_REMOTE
|
|
|
|
bool "Remote memory location (PCI)"
|
|
|
|
|
|
|
|
config SYS_QE_FMAN_FW_IN_ROM
|
|
|
|
bool "Firmware is already in ROM"
|
|
|
|
|
|
|
|
endchoice
|